Output 6aa933428d15012ca10ba9c8358cecf4dbee22a080aad173ae7e90afff51dd77:15

value
54182274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c00eb82b94055cb31324d7491c61accbe21e12 OP_EQUAL
address
M8EzLPqZhXXAHZ5v3WK4heRzNeWP2goXHf
transaction
6aa933428d15012ca10ba9c8358cecf4dbee22a080aad173ae7e90afff51dd77
spent
true